A semiconductor device in which an output voltage is generated in response to the intensity of a magnetic field applied to a wire. In an actuator, the varying magnetic field is produced by the rotation of a permanent magnet past a thin wire. The pulses generated serve to count the number of rotations of the motor.
A type of position sensor that senses magnetic field strength and produces a voltage that changes with this strength. Hall sensors can have digital or analog outputs.
A Hall effect sensor is a transducer that varies its output voltage in response to changes in magnetic field density. Hall sensors are used for proximity switching, positioning, speed detection, and current sensing applications.
